Impresiv Health vs Laurel: Revenue, Funding & Team Size Compared
Impresiv Health generates $7.4M in revenue; Laurel generates $7.5M. Laurel and Impresiv Health are close to the same size by revenue. The table below compares Impresiv Health and Laurel on funding, valuation, customers, team size and headquarters — every figure GetLatka has verified for each company.
| Company | ||
|---|---|---|
| Revenue | $7.4M | $7.5M |
| Funding raised | Not disclosed | $55.7M |
| Team size | 30 | 111 |
| Founded | 2014 | 2018 |
| HQ | Longwood, United States | San Francisco, United States |
